Enable job alerts via email!
A leading biotech company is seeking a Senior Software Engineer in Toronto to enhance its bioinformatics capabilities. The successful candidate will maintain cloud-based data pipelines and provide DevOps support to machine learning teams. Ideal applicants will have extensive experience in software engineering, cloud services, and be proficient in Python and Linux. This role promises a dynamic work environment focused on advancing drug discovery through technology.
Coders Connect is partnering with a trailblazing biotech company that's leveraging real patient biology and AI to accelerate drug discovery. Their platform maps how therapies affect human cells in vivo, creating one of the world’s largest perturbation atlases to train next-generation foundation models.
What You’ll Be Doing :
We’re looking for a Senior Software Engineer to help scale bioinformatics pipelines and support machine learning workflows in a high-performance cloud environment. This role sits at the intersection of data engineering, infrastructure, and scientific computing.
Maintain and scale cloud-based data pipelines in production
Provide DevOps support to ML and research teams
Administer cloud infrastructure (AWS preferred) and GPU scheduling (e.g., RunAI)
Collaborate with bioinformaticians, ML engineers, and scientists on complex data flows
Build scalable software systems for high-throughput biological data analysis
Requirements
Bonus Points For :
Background in bioinformatics or healthtech
Experience supporting regulated industries (e.g., life sciences)
Familiarity with R or data visualization in biology
Metaflow, Snakemake, RunAI
Linux-based environments
Requirements
5+ years of software engineering experience Strong Python skills and Linux proficiency Experience with cloud services (AWS, GCP, or Azure) and containerization (Docker) Familiarity with pipeline orchestration tools like Metaflow or Snakemake Exposure to big data environments and scalable system design
Senior Software Engineer • Toronto, ON, ca